What Are Mining and Staking?
Mining is the process of validating transactions and securing a blockchain using computing power. Miners earn block rewards and transaction fees in return for their efforts. It’s commonly associated with proof-of-work (PoW) coins.
Staking, on the other hand, is used in proof-of-stake (PoS) networks. Instead of using hardware to validate transactions, stakers lock up a portion of their crypto in the network, earning rewards based on the amount staked and the duration.
Both methods generate consistent earnings, but their profitability depends on network difficulty, coin price, and operational costs — all of which can be evaluated using a crypto calculator.
Using a Profitability Calculator for Mining and Staking
A profitability calculator crypto is an essential tool for anyone looking to mine or stake digital currencies. It allows users to forecast daily, monthly, or yearly earnings based on current metrics.
For Mining:
To calculate mining rewards, input:
-
Hash rate (your hardware’s processing power)
-
Power consumption (in watts)
-
Electricity cost (per kWh)
-
Network difficulty
-
Current coin price
The calculator will estimate your expected earnings and subtract electricity costs, giving you a clear picture of net profit. This is especially useful when considering whether a coin is worth mining based on current market conditions.
For Staking:
To calculate staking rewards, input:
-
Amount staked
-
Staking duration
-
Annual percentage yield (APY)
-
Compounding frequency
The calculator will show how much crypto you’ll earn over time, helping you choose the best staking pool or decide how long to lock in your funds for maximum gain.
